.whzh--post--top-bar{color:var(--color-red)}.whzh--post--top-bar a:hover,.whzh--post--top-bar a:active,.whzh--post--top-bar a:focus{color:var(--color-black);text-decoration:underline}.whzh--post--section-title{font-weight:var(--font-weight-bold)}.whzh--post--sidebar-affix{display:none}.whzh--post--logos{max-width:-moz-max-content;max-width:max-content;margin-inline:auto;display:flex;flex-flow:row wrap;justify-content:center;align-items:center}.whzh--post--logos-title{font-family:var(--font-family-sans-serif);font-weight:var(--font-weight-semibold);font-size:1rem;text-transform:uppercase;text-align:center;line-height:1;width:100%}.whzh--post--logos p{margin:0;padding:1rem}.whzh--post--logos p a{width:clamp(8rem,5.5146rem + 9.3567vw,10rem);display:block}.whzh--post--logos img,.whzh--post--logos svg{display:inline-block;color:var(--post-theme-color, var(--color-red))}.btn-whzh{color:var(--post-theme-color, var(--color-red));font-family:var(--font-family-sans-serif);font-weight:var(--font-weight-semibold);font-size:1rem;text-align:center;text-transform:uppercase;line-height:1;border:1px solid var(--post-theme-color, var(--color-red));border-radius:3px;border-color:var(--post-theme-color, var(--color-red));padding:.75rem 1.25rem;display:inline-block}.btn-whzh:after{content:"";background-color:var(--post-theme-color, var(--color-red));-webkit-mask-image:var(--icon-arrow-top-xs);mask-image:var(--icon-arrow-top-xs);-webkit-mask-size:contain;mask-size:contain;-webkit-mask-position:center;mask-position:center;-webkit-mask-repeat:no-repeat;mask-repeat:no-repeat;transition:background-color .15s ease-in-out;width:8px;height:9px;margin-left:.5em;display:inline-block;transform:rotate(90deg)}.btn-whzh:hover,.btn-whzh:active,.btn-whzh:focus{color:var(--bg-body);border-color:var(--post-theme-color, var(--color-red));background:var(--post-theme-color, var(--color-red))}.btn-whzh:hover:after,.btn-whzh:active:after,.btn-whzh:focus:after{background-color:var(--color-white)}.whzh--post--footer-msg{font-size:1.125rem;line-height:1.6;text-align:center;padding:0 2rem}.whzh--post--footer-msg h3{color:var(--color-red);font-weight:var(--font-weight-bold);font-size:2rem;line-height:1;margin:0}.whzh--post--footer-msg h4{font-size:1.125rem;font-weight:var(--font-weight-semibold);line-height:1;margin:.5rem 0 0}.whzh--post--footer-msg p{font-size:inherit!important;line-height:inherit!important;margin:2rem 0 0}.whzh--post--footer-msg a{color:var(--color-black);font-weight:var(--font-weight-semibold)}.whzh--post--footer-msg a:hover,.whzh--post--footer-msg a:active,.whzh--post--footer-msg a:focus{color:var(--post-theme-color, var(--color-red))}.whzh--post--footer-logos ul{list-style:none;margin:0;padding:0;display:flex;flex-flow:row wrap;justify-content:center;align-items:center}.whzh--post--footer-logos li{padding:.75rem;width:clamp(8rem,5.5146rem + 9.3567vw,10rem)}.whzh--post--footer-logos li._75{width:clamp(8rem,8rem + 0vw,8rem)}.whzh--post--footer-logos svg{color:var(--post-theme-color, var(--color-red))}@media screen and (max-width: 991px){.whzh--post--logos-title{margin-bottom:1rem!important}.whzh--post--logos-title span{background:var(--bg-body);padding:.75rem 1.5rem 0;display:inline-block}}@media screen and (max-width: 767px){.whzh--post--logos-title{margin-bottom:.5rem!important}}@media screen and (min-width: 768px){.whzh--post--footer{padding-bottom:2rem}.whzh--post--footer--container{width:83.33333333%;margin-inline:8.33333333%}.whzh--post--footer-msg{font-size:1.25rem}.whzh--post--footer-logos{margin-bottom:3rem}.whzh--post--footer-logos li{padding:0 1.5rem;width:clamp(11rem,9.2222rem + 3.7037vw,12rem)}.whzh--post--footer-logos li._75{width:clamp(9rem,7.2222rem + 3.7037vw,10rem)}}@media screen and (min-width: 992px){.whzh--post--sidebar-affix{display:block}.whzh--post--logos{margin-bottom:3rem;justify-content:flex-start}.whzh--post--logos-title span{padding:0}.whzh--post--logos p{text-align:left;padding:0}.whzh--post--logos p+p{margin-top:1.75rem}.whzh--post--footer{padding-top:5rem;padding-bottom:3rem}.whzh--post--footer--container{width:66.66666667%;margin-inline:16.66666667%}}@media screen and (min-width: 1200px){.whzh--post--footer-msg{font-size:1.5rem}.whzh--post--footer-msg h3{font-size:2.5rem}.whzh--post--footer-msg h4{font-size:1.25rem}.whzh--post--footer-logos{margin-bottom:4rem}}
